DTC P2105: THROTTLE ACTUATOR CONTROL (TAC) SYSTEM: FORCED ENGINE SHUTDOWN

Description:  This DTC sets when the TAC system is in the failure mode effects management (FMEM) mode of forced engine shutdown.
Possible Causes: 
Diagnostic Aids:  This DTC is an informational DTC and may set in combination with a number of other DTCs which are causing the FMEM. Diagnose other DTCs first.
